Enrique Iglesias to Re-Release "Euphoria," Records Spanish Version of Lil Wayne Hit
Enrique Iglesias has a holiday treat for his fans. A spokesperson for Enrique tells ABC News Radio that come November, Enrique will release a new version of his album Euphoria with three new tracks, plus both the clean and dirty versions of "Tonight (I'm Loving You.)"
The spokesperson also confirms a report by MTV that Enrique has recorded a Spanish version of Lil Wayne's hit "How to Love," called "Como Amar." Enrique previously collaborated with Weezy on "Dirty Dancer," and also on the 2007 song "Push." Right now, it's unclear exactly when "Como Amar" will be released.
In related news, DJ Frank E, who produced "Tonight (I'm Loving You)," tweeted on Tuesday that a new song featuring both Enrique and Jennifer Lopez was "coming soon." He then tweeted the title, "Mouth 2 Mouth." It's also unclear when and where that song will be released.
